In this tutorial, we show you how to get your very own Bitcoin wallet and address in minutes with our mobile app BridgeWallet. With it, you will be able to send, receive, buy, swap and sell Bitcoin from your phone.
1: Download Bridge Wallet
BridgeWallet is the free mobile app that we have made to easily invest in Bitcoin from your phone. Download the app, install it and then launch it.
The first step after launching the app is to create a password and confirm it, which will allow you to access the wallet later on.
Make sure to choose a password that you will remember, as there isn't any "I forgot my password" option for security reasons.
3: Create a new wallet
Choose here the "Create a new wallet" option. The other option is to access an existing address in case you already have one.
4: Generate a secret phrase
Choose here the "Generate a secret phrase" option. The split secret phrase is an advanced form of secret phrase, if you don't know what it is you can ignore it.
Let's verify here that you have backed up your secret phrase. If you haven't, you can still click "Back" and back it up. It's really important to do it properly now, so you'll be all set from now on.
This check won't ask you all the words, only a few of them. Make sure to enter the secret word number asked.
8: Success!
That's it, you're done creating a new Bitcoin wallet!
9: See your Bitcoin address
You can now start using your wallet to send, receive, buy, swap and sell BTC. To see and share your public Bitcoin address, switch to the Bitcoin network via the icon on the top left of the app screen and go in the "Addresses" tab of the app.

Using a cold wallet to store crypto. Hot wallets can be extremely secure if you use them correctly, but they can still be compromised if your device becomes infected with keystroke logging software. This is where using a cold wallet can help to protect you further.
BTC is a digital currency that is stored in an electronic wallet that can be accessed by using a private key. However, you don't have to do this directly. A wallet app automatically uses a private key to sign the outgoing transactions and generate wallet addresses for you.
Anyone can generate a Bitcoin wallet address. You can create a new wallet address using a wallet software or online tool. However, only the original owner of the address has access to the private keys, which allows them to spend or transfer the Bitcoins associated with that address.
